Backup internet is more than ordering a second circuit
Two services can still share upstream infrastructure, building pathways, equipment or other dependencies. A practical redundancy review considers provider diversity, physical path diversity where available, circuit type, firewall and routing behavior, power continuity and how critical applications behave during failover.

Multi-location redundancy
For organizations operating many sites, redundancy should be managed as a portfolio rather than one emergency at a time. Circuit inventory, renewal dates, provider diversity and site criticality can be used to prioritize where secondary connectivity creates the greatest business value.

Does a second internet circuit guarantee uptime?
No. Redundancy reduces specific risks but does not eliminate every failure mode. The design should be matched to the business requirement and available infrastructure.
Can the backup circuit use a different provider?
Often, and provider diversity can be valuable. The actual options depend on the service address and available infrastructure.
